
HOW DOES PUNCTUALITY AFFECT SUCCESS?

There are certain habits that set you on the path of success and punctuality is one. Punctuality is a key attribute of success. A responsible person is always conscious of time and how it relates with opportunities.

Punctuality is an important social behavior at the workplace and in everyday life. Being on time is vital to develop and maintain satisfying relationships with others, to structure one’s life, and to be successful in all areas of life.

Thus, the importance of being punctual cannot be overemphasized.
Punctuality is the habit of attending a task on time. In a wider sense, it is a habit of doing things at the right time. It is an excellent trait that a person inherits or builds and is always admired and respected by most people.
When you’re punctual it shows your respect for others, your work and your outlook towards life and so you qualify yourself to earn respect as well.

Being punctual gives you adequate time to settle and start your work on time and have better chances to get more accomplished than when you’re late.

It eliminates stress from your life, lessens the anxiety of being late and helps you in being calm and organized.

Punctuality builds credibility and is a sign of professionalism and commitment whether you are a professional or a student, and helps you stand out as a reliable and trustworthy person in front of others. It also improves others’ perception of you and people start seeing you as a mature, serious and devoted individual. This will help them to build faith in you and at the same time rely on you for important tasks.

Being punctual also portrays your integrity as a person that can be trusted.

In a nutshell, it will suffice to say that punctuality means success. It is a habit that helps you earn the respect and trust of other people. It also enables you to move ahead in your career. Finally, when you’re punctual it inspires others around you to do the same and you can contribute positively to society as well.
